
Melhores Alternativas ao PokerStars para Bots de Poker com IA
O PokerStars emprega mais de 60 especialistas dedicados a detectar e banir bots. Se você é um desenvolvedor construindo IA para poker, todas as grandes salas comerciais vão suspender sua conta e confiscar seu saldo. Aqui estão seis alternativas ao PokerStars para bots de IA onde seu código é realmente bem-vindo.
Por que o PokerStars bane bots?
O PokerStars é uma plataforma de poker humano contra humano. Todo o negócio deles depende de jogadores recreativos se sentindo seguros na mesa. Um bot que joga poker GTO perfeito em 10 mesas simultaneamente não é divertido de enfrentar, e jogadores que não estão se divertindo param de depositar. O incentivo econômico para banir bots é enorme: o PokerStars processou $71 bilhões em inscrições de torneios em 2024.
Não vou fingir que a posição anti-bot deles está errada. É a política correta para uma plataforma que serve jogadores recreativos. O problema é que isso deixa desenvolvedores como nós sem lugar para ir. O GGPoker bane HUDs de terceiros completamente. O 888poker roda detecção comportamental. O PartyPoker sinaliza durações de sessão irregulares. Se você passou semanas construindo um agente de poker e quer testá-lo contra oponentes reais, o ecossistema de poker comercial te trata como uma ameaça.
Isso cria uma lacuna real. Self-play treina seu bot contra um espelho de si mesmo. Você nunca descobre que sua frequência de bluff no river é explorável, ou que seu sizing de 3-bet vaza informação, até enfrentar um oponente que pune esses padrões. Ambientes acadêmicos ajudam, mas são ou apenas para estudantes, ou apenas heads-up, ou apenas offline.
Então para onde você vai? Eu avaliei todas as plataformas que encontrei onde bots de poker podem competir. Aqui está a análise completa.
1. Open Poker (openpoker.ai)
Melhor para: desenvolvedores que querem testar bots contra oponentes diversos em um ambiente competitivo e persistente.
Open Poker é a plataforma que eu construí especificamente para esse problema. É uma arena competitiva gratuita onde bots de IA jogam No-Limit Texas Hold'em via WebSocket. Qualquer linguagem de programação. Mesas de seis jogadores. Temporadas de duas semanas com leaderboard público e prêmios em USDC.
Seu bot conecta em wss://openpoker.ai/ws, entra na fila de matchmaking e joga mãos contra bots escritos por outros desenvolvedores. O protocolo é stateless no lado do cliente: cada mensagem your_turn inclui o estado completo do jogo, então você não precisa rastrear nada entre mensagens. Tomei essa decisão depois de ver meus três primeiros bots de teste desenvolverem bugs de sincronização de estado dentro de 50 mãos.
Cada temporada, todo bot começa com 5.000 chips virtuais com blinds de 10/20. A pontuação no leaderboard é chips + chips_at_table, mínimo de 10 mãos para se qualificar. Os 30 melhores dividem o prize pool; os 3 melhores ganham badges permanentes. Depois todos resetam e a próxima temporada começa.
Preço: O plano gratuito dá acesso competitivo completo. O Pro ($5/temporada) adiciona gráficos de win-rate contínuos, P&L por sessão, perfis de estratégia personalizados e cooldowns de rebuy mais curtos.
Prós:
- Construído para bots desde o início, não como um recurso secundário
- Multiplayer real contra estratégias diversas que você não escreveu
- Qualquer linguagem que suporta WebSocket funciona (guia de início rápido)
- Infraestrutura gerenciada: matchmaking, pots, side pots, tratamento de desconexão, recuperação de crashes
- Leaderboard público cria pressão competitiva genuína
Contras:
- Apenas 6-max NLHE (sem torneios, sem PLO, sem mesas heads-up ainda)
- O pool de jogadores ainda está crescendo (lançado em março de 2026)
- Sem cash games, apenas chips virtuais
Sou tendencioso aqui, obviamente. Construí o Open Poker porque precisava dele e não consegui encontrar. Se você quer entender o raciocínio por trás das decisões de design, escrevi sobre isso em por que construímos o Open Poker.
2. Slumbot
Melhor para: fazer benchmark do jogo heads-up do seu bot contra um oponente forte conhecido.
Slumbot é um bot gratuito de No-Limit Hold'em heads-up construído com Counterfactual Regret Minimization (CFR). Está rodando desde 2012 e tem uma API bem documentada. Você envia históricos de mãos, ele responde com ações. É o mais próximo de um oponente sobre-humano publicamente disponível para poker HU.
Eric Jackson, criador do Slumbot, treinou o bot em bilhões de mãos simuladas usando uma versão abstraída de CFR. A estratégia que ele joga é próxima de GTO para jogo heads-up, o que o torna um bom parâmetro de comparação. Se seu bot consegue se manter contra o Slumbot por mais de 10.000 mãos, você está no caminho certo.
Preço: Gratuito.
Prós:
- Oponente forte e conhecido com estratégia próxima de GTO
- Gratuito e sempre disponível
- Bom para medir habilidade bruta em heads-up
Contras:
- Apenas heads-up. Sem multiplayer
- Oponente fixo único. Sem diversidade de estratégias
- Sem leaderboard, sem temporadas, sem estrutura competitiva
- Documentação da API é mínima
O Slumbot é excelente no que faz: um benchmark. Ele não vai te dizer como seu bot performa em um jogo de 6 jogadores onde posição importa mais, stack depths variam e oponentes vão de ultra-tight a maníacos.
3. MIT Pokerbots
Melhor para: estudantes que querem um sprint competitivo intenso de um mês com prêmios significativos.
MIT Pokerbots é uma competição anual organizada por estudantes do MIT, geralmente em janeiro. Times constroem bots que jogam uma variante customizada de poker (as regras mudam a cada ano) em um torneio de um mês. Os prize pools ultrapassaram $50.000 nos últimos anos, patrocinados por empresas como Jane Street e HRT.
A competição de 2025 usou uma variante de três jogadores com cartas comunitárias forçadas, o que muda a matemática significativamente em relação ao NLHE padrão. Anos anteriores incluíram variantes com estruturas de ante, tamanhos de aposta restritos e rankings de mãos modificados.
Preço: Gratuito para participar (apenas times de estudantes do MIT; alguns anos abertos a times de universidades externas).
Prós:
- Prêmios substanciais ($50K+)
- Competição de alto calibre (empresas de finanças quantitativas recrutam a partir dela)
- Força você a construir do zero sob pressão de tempo
Contras:
- Apenas para estudantes. Se você não está em uma universidade, não pode participar
- Variante customizada a cada ano, não poker padrão
- Funciona por um mês anualmente, depois nada
- Sem API persistente ou jogo durante o ano todo
Se você é estudante, MIT Pokerbots é uma ótima experiência. Se você é um desenvolvedor profissional ou pesquisador, não é uma opção.
4. OpenSpiel (DeepMind)
Melhor para: pesquisadores treinando agentes em ambientes de teoria dos jogos com bases algorítmicas sólidas.
OpenSpiel é o framework open-source do DeepMind para pesquisa em jogos. Inclui implementações de variantes de poker (Kuhn poker, Leduc Hold'em, vários formatos simplificados de NLHE) junto com algoritmos como CFR, MCCFR, deep CFR, AlphaZero e métodos de policy gradient. O paper do framework foi publicado em 2020.
As implementações de poker no OpenSpiel são simplificadas. NLHE completo com bet sizing contínuo não é suportado diretamente. Você precisaria implementar abstrações (bucketing de ações, abstração de cartas) por conta própria. O framework lida com travessia de game tree e plumbing de algoritmos, mas você está fazendo self-play contra seus próprios agentes treinados.
Preço: Gratuito, open-source (Apache 2.0).
Prós:
- Mantido pela DeepMind, bem documentado, citado academicamente
- Implementações fortes de algoritmos (variantes de CFR, métodos de RL)
- Suporte multi-jogo se você está fazendo pesquisa de IA em jogos gerais
- Comunidade ativa e atualizações regulares
Contras:
- Apenas self-play. Sem oponentes online
- Variantes simplificadas de poker, não NLHE completo
- Core em C++ com bindings Python, setup complexo para não-pesquisadores
- Sem estrutura competitiva ou leaderboard
OpenSpiel é uma ferramenta de pesquisa, não uma plataforma de competição. É excelente para treinar e estudar algoritmos. Mas treinar um bot no OpenSpiel e nunca testá-lo contra oponentes diversos é como treinar um boxeador que só faz shadowboxing.
5. RLCard
Melhor para: desenvolvedores Python que querem um ambiente rápido de treinamento RL para jogos de cartas.
RLCard é um toolkit Python para reinforcement learning em jogos de cartas. Suporta Blackjack, UNO, Mahjong e várias variantes de poker incluindo Limit Hold'em e No-Limit Hold'em. O paper do toolkit foi publicado pelo DATA Lab da Rice University em 2019.
RLCard é mais simples que OpenSpiel, mas mais focado. Fornece ambientes limpos no estilo Gym, modelos pré-treinados para comparação e ferramentas de visualização. Você pode ter um agente DQN treinando em NLHE em uma hora. O ambiente NLHE usa um espaço de ações abstraído e fixo (fold, check, call, raise half-pot, raise pot, all-in), o que simplifica a implementação mas limita a profundidade estratégica.
Preço: Gratuito, open-source (licença MIT).
Prós:
- API Python limpa, fácil de começar
- Agentes pré-treinados para benchmarking imediato
- Boa documentação e exemplos em Jupyter notebook
Contras:
- Apenas ambiente de treinamento. Sem oponentes online
- Espaços de ações abstraídos perdem o bet sizing contínuo
- Comunidade menor que OpenSpiel
- Sem contexto competitivo
RLCard é um bom ponto de partida para aprender RL com poker. Uma vez que seu agente está treinado, você vai querer testá-lo em algum lugar com oponentes reais.
6. PokerBattle.ai
Melhor para: desenvolvedores de LLM curiosos sobre como modelos de linguagem performam no poker.
PokerBattle.ai realizou um torneio único de poker com LLMs em outubro de 2025 onde modelos de linguagem (GPT-4, Claude, Llama, etc.) jogaram poker simplificado uns contra os outros. O torneio demonstrou que os LLMs atuais são jogadores de poker medíocres, o que não foi surpresa: eles não têm a capacidade de fazer estimativa de probabilidade em tempo real e modelagem de oponentes que agentes construídos para esse fim dominam.
Preço: O evento de outubro de 2025 foi gratuito para participar.
Prós:
- Conceito inovador: poker LLM contra LLM
- Dados interessantes sobre capacidades de raciocínio de LLMs
- Barreira de entrada baixa (basta fornecer acesso à API)
Contras:
- Evento único, não uma plataforma persistente
- Formato de jogo simplificado
- Apenas LLMs (sem agentes construídos especificamente)
- Sem indicação de eventos futuros
PokerBattle.ai foi um experimento divertido. Mas se você está construindo um agente de poker sério (não embrulhando um LLM), não há nada para conectar hoje.
Comparação rápida
| Plataforma | Jogo | Multiplayer | Jogo Online | Persistente | Custo | Melhor Para |
|---|---|---|---|---|---|---|
| Open Poker | 6-max NLHE | Sim | Sim | Sim (temporadas) | Gratuito / $5 Pro | Teste competitivo de bots |
| Slumbot | HU NLHE | Não (1v1 vs bot) | Sim | Sim | Gratuito | Benchmark HU |
| MIT Pokerbots | Variante customizada | Sim | Sim (apenas jan) | Não | Gratuito (estudantes) | Competições estudantis |
| OpenSpiel | Poker simplificado | Não (self-play) | Não | N/A | Gratuito | Pesquisa de algoritmos |
| RLCard | NLHE abstraído | Não (self-play) | Não | N/A | Gratuito | Treinamento RL |
| PokerBattle.ai | Simplificado | Sim (apenas LLM) | Não (baseado em eventos) | Não | Gratuito | Experimentos com LLM |
Qual alternativa você deve escolher?
Depende do que você está tentando fazer, e vou dar respostas diretas.
Se você quer competir contra outros bots agora, use o Open Poker. É a única plataforma com multiplayer persistente, oponentes diversos e um leaderboard. Seu bot conecta em 5 minutos com o guia de início rápido, e pode estar jogando mãos ranqueadas dentro de uma hora. Eu construí porque nada mais existia para esse caso de uso.
Se você quer fazer benchmark contra um único oponente forte, jogue seu bot contra o Slumbot. É o padrão ouro para jogo heads-up. Rode mais de 10.000 mãos e meça seu win rate em big blinds por 100 mãos (bb/100). Qualquer coisa positiva contra o Slumbot é impressionante.
Se você está fazendo pesquisa acadêmica em algoritmos de teoria dos jogos, use OpenSpiel. As implementações de CFR são battle-tested, e você pode comparar seu algoritmo novo contra baselines estabelecidas.
Se você está aprendendo RL com jogos de cartas, comece com RLCard. A interface Gym é familiar, os exemplos funcionam direto e você terá um agente treinado rápido.
Se você é estudante, procure o MIT Pokerbots em janeiro.
Para uma comparação lado a lado mais detalhada de API, regras e preços, veja a matriz completa de comparação de plataformas. A realidade honesta: a maioria dessas opções são ambientes de treinamento ou eventos únicos. Se você quer que seu bot enfrente oponentes que nunca viu, em um jogo que roda continuamente, existe realmente uma opção agora.
FAQ
Posso rodar um bot de poker no PokerStars sem ser banido?
Não. O PokerStars detecta e bane bots ativamente. Eles empregam mais de 60 especialistas e usam análise comportamental, detecção de padrões de jogo e monitoramento de duração de sessão. Se pego, sua conta é suspensa e seu saldo pode ser confiscado. Isso se aplica ao GGPoker, 888poker e PartyPoker também.
Qual é a melhor plataforma gratuita para testar bots de poker com IA em 2026?
Open Poker (openpoker.ai) oferece jogo competitivo gratuito com multiplayer real, leaderboard público e prêmios em USDC. Slumbot é gratuito para benchmarking heads-up. OpenSpiel e RLCard são gratuitos para treinamento offline. Para competição multiplayer de bot contra bot, Open Poker é a única opção gratuita persistente.
Preciso usar Python para construir um bot de poker?
Não. Open Poker aceita qualquer linguagem que possa abrir uma conexão WebSocket e parsear JSON. Python, JavaScript, Rust, Go, Java, C++ e outras funcionam. Confira como construir um bot de poker em Python se quiser um exemplo funcional em menos de 50 linhas.
É legal rodar bots de poker?
Em plataformas comerciais como o PokerStars, usar bots viola os Termos de Serviço. Não é crime na maioria das jurisdições (EUA, UE e maior parte da Ásia tratam como violação contratual, não crime), mas eles vão te banir e confiscar seu saldo. Em plataformas específicas para bots como o Open Poker, bots são o ponto principal. Não há jogadores humanos para proteger, então não há questão ética ou legal. Países como Reino Unido, Malta e Gibraltar regulam poker online através de órgãos de licenciamento, mas nenhum deles tem estatutos criminais específicos para bots até 2026.
Como sei se meu bot de poker é realmente bom?
Ao longo de uma amostra estatisticamente significativa (mínimo de 5.000 mãos), meça seu win rate em big blinds por 100 mãos. No Open Poker, o leaderboard faz isso automaticamente ao longo de uma temporada de 2 semanas. Contra o Slumbot, acompanhe seus resultados por pelo menos 10.000 mãos para reduzir a variância.
Seu bot merece oponentes que realmente contra-atacam. Crie uma conta gratuita no Open Poker e tenha ele jogando mãos ranqueadas em menos de 10 minutos.